Essential facts and insights about ICD-10 Coding for Nephrosclerosis
Use ICD-10 code I12.9 for hypertensive chronic kidney disease with stage 1-4 or unspecified ckd, ensuring proper documentation in clinical notes.

The ICD-10 code for hypertensive nephrosclerosis is I12.9, used when hypertension is documented as the cause of CKD stages 1-4.
Document hypertensive nephrosclerosis by linking hypertension to CKD, specifying the CKD stage, and including relevant lab results.
